Abstract

   All animal-pollinated plants must solve the problem of attracting pollinators
   while remaining inconspicuous to herbivores, a dilemma exacerbated when voracious
   larval-stage herbivores mature into important pollinators for a plant [1].
   Herbivory is known to alter pollination rates, by altering flower number [2],
   size [3, 4], nectar production [5], seasonal timing of flowering [6], or
   pollinator behavior [7]. Nicotiana attenuata, a night-flowering tobacco that
   germinates after fires in the Southwestern United States, normally produces
   flowers that open at night and release benzyl acetone (BA) to attract
   night-active hawkmoth pollinators (Manduca quinquemaculata and M. sexta), which
   are both herbivores and pollinators. When plants are attacked by hawkmoth larvae,
   the plants produce flowers with reduced BA emissions that open in the morning and
   are preferentially pollinated by day-active hummingbirds. This dramatic change in
   flower phenology, which is elicited by oral secretions (OSs) from feeding
   hawkmoth larvae and requires jasmonate (JA) signal transduction, causes the
   majority of outcrossed seeds to be produced by pollinations from day-active
   hummingbirds rather than night-active hawkmoths. Because oviposition and
   nectaring are frequently coupled behaviors in hawkmoths, we propose that this
   OS-elicited, JA-mediated change in flower phenology complements similarly
   elicited responses to herbivore attack (direct defenses, indirect defenses, and
   tolerance responses) that reduce the risk and fitness consequences of herbivory
   to plants.
